Map of states in Canada with Dr. Louie stores

Dr. Louie store locator Canada displays complete list and huge database of Dr. Louie stores, factory stores, shops and boutiques in Canada. Dr. Louie information: map of Canada, shopping hours, contact information.
Dr. Louie stores located in Canada: 1
Largest shopping mall with Dr. Louie store in Canada: Westbrook Mall
Search all Dr. Louie stores located in Canada